About (5R)-2,9-diazaspiro[4.5]decane
(5R)-2,9-diazaspiro[4.5]decane (PubChem CID 86326439) has the molecular formula C8H16N2
and a molecular weight of 140.23 g/mol. Its IUPAC name is (5R)-2,9-diazaspiro[4.5]decane.
